Garlic is also full of vitamins and nutrients too. Research shows that a 1 ounce (28 grams) serving of garlic contains):

Manganese: 23% of the RDA
Vitamin B6: 17% of the RDA
Vitamin C: 15% of the RDA
Selenium: 6% of the RDA
Fiber: 0.6 gram
Decent amounts of calcium, copper, potassium, phosphorus, iron, vitamin B1, selenium and others
